A legitimate bad take. Not only does this ignore that for the majority of Levi's career, he had borderline All-Pro Tre White across the field, along with Poyer and Hyde (gee, if I was an offensive coordinator, I wonder who I would throw at), but it's also completely not supported by the numbers. Levi Wallace his last season in Buffalo, aka sans Tre White for a large part of the year, allowed a passer rating of 72.6 when targeted. Dane last year allowed 82.1. Elam allowed a tremendously bad 96.3. Benford allowed 84.1. Levi Wallace was the victim of being a solid player surrounding by stars, and the weakest player in the secondary by default. And this caused him to get vilified by the people who don't know what they are talking about. He's a better player the the three "solid depth" amigos who can't seem to break out of the mediocre paper bag they are stuck in.

It's the latter. It is one thing if Benford/Jackson were playing like All-Pros or even high end starters. Unfortunately, they (and Elam) are all in that "serviceable" bucket. Levi Wallace was serviceable. We got rid of him and drafted Elam, which was a clear signal that the Bills wanted to upgrade at the CB2 position. Strategically, it made a lot of sense, a cheap, cost-controlled first rounder to pair until Tre White's contract was over or we moved on. In an ideal world, Elam would have taken the starting job last year (he had a perfect opportunity with only Dane above him on the depth chart), and he failed to do so. Even worse, now with a year of NFL experience, he can't separate from lesser players physically. Now, all that being said, there's a non-zero chance Tre White is on the chopping block after 2023 regardless if he looks like the ghost he did last year. Hopefully, he shakes off the cobwebs and returns to form. It gave me 2016 vibes. Sometimes you don't need to wait three years to realize the whole group wasn't up to snuff. If Benford and Cook can also see PT, it will soften the blow, but agreed entirely. I will be surprised if Elam is a Bill in 2024.
